关于sql server的存储过程在事务中不能执行的问题?(100分)

  • 主题发起人 诸葛白痴
  • 开始时间

诸葛白痴

Unregistered / Unconfirmed
GUEST, unregistred user!
1、小弟在用aod+sql server时知道存储过程不能在事务中执行,这时如果要取得事务这样的
效果,应用什么方法代替呢,怎样才能保证其能向事务一样的功能!
2、有几个常用的系统存储过程的参数问题?
 sp_password @old这个参数本来可以是一个null值,但要用adostoredproc->parameters
->createparameter("@id",ftString,pdInput,20,NULL),可是到后面来是不对,本来如果是
NULL的话就不会提示我输入旧密码,为什么还为,我是用BCB访问的?
 sp_addlogin @sid这是一个varbinarys类型变量,为什么要传给它ftVarBytes会出错
说类型变量不对呢? 如果我用让一个登录只能对我创建的数据库访问,应怎样分配其
权限呢?是角色还是什么?
 
存储过程中放事务处理
 
可是有时外部的程序代码(非数据库,但跟数据库有关)的是不能放在存储过程中的啊
 
接受答案了.
 
顶部